解决v2ray 500内部服务器错误的详细指南

引言

在使用v2ray时,许多用户可能会遇到 500内部服务器错误,这一问题不仅影响了用户的上网体验,也让很多人感到困惑。本文将对这一错误进行深入分析,帮助用户理解其产生的原因,并提供有效的解决方案。

什么是v2ray 500内部服务器错误?

500内部服务器错误 是一个通用的HTTP状态代码,意味着服务器在处理请求时遇到了意外情况。对v2ray用户来说,这个错误通常意味着配置或服务端存在问题,导致请求无法被成功处理。

v2ray 500内部服务器错误的常见原因

1. 配置错误

  • 配置文件不正确:如果v2ray的配置文件中的格式或参数不符合要求,可能会导致500错误。
  • 无效的端口设置:确保所有端口配置都已正确设置并且没有冲突。

2. 服务器问题

  • 资源不足:服务器的内存或CPU资源不足也会导致无法处理请求,从而返回500错误。
  • 网络问题:网络连接问题可能导致服务器无法正确响应请求。

3. 软件版本问题

  • 不兼容版本:使用不兼容的v2ray版本可能会导致一些意想不到的问题,包括500错误。

如何排查v2ray 500内部服务器错误

1. 检查v2ray配置

  • 逐行检查v2ray的配置文件,确保所有设置均为正确。
  • 使用在线工具验证JSON格式的有效性。

2. 查看服务器日志

  • v2ray服务器通常会生成日志文件,检查这些日志文件以获取更多的错误信息。
  • 特别关注与请求处理相关的部分,寻找任何异常的输出。

3. 资源监控

  • 使用系统监控工具(如htop或top)查看服务器的CPU和内存使用情况,确保没有过载。
  • 评估是否需要升级服务器的硬件或使用负载均衡。

解决v2ray 500内部服务器错误的方法

1. 修正配置文件

  • 确保配置文件中的每一项设置均符合v2ray的文档要求,特别注意语法错误和格式问题。

2. 更新软件版本

  • 定期检查并更新v2ray到最新的稳定版本,确保软件功能与性能保持最佳状态。

3. 增加服务器资源

  • 如果资源不足,考虑升级服务器配置或者迁移到性能更高的主机。

FAQ(常见问题解答)

1. 如何确认是500内部服务器错误?

可以通过浏览器查看返回的HTTP状态码来确认。如果返回状态码为500,则说明存在内部服务器错误。

2. v2ray出现500错误该如何快速解决?

建议首先检查配置文件及日志文件,确认错误来源,然后依据具体错误信息进行修复。

3. 会不会是我的网络问题导致500错误?

是的,网络不稳定或服务器无法访问都可能导致请求失败,因此也需要检查网络连接。

4. 500错误是否会影响我的隐私?

在正常情况下,500错误本身不会泄露用户的隐私信息,但错误日志可能包含某些敏感信息,因此应妥善处理这些日志。

结论

通过对v2ray 500内部服务器错误的全面分析和具体解决方案的提供,用户可以更快地找到问题的根源并有效解决这一常见的技术难题。在日常使用中,建议定期检查配置和更新软件,以确保服务的稳定和可靠。希望本文能对广大v2ray用户有所帮助。

正文完